In theaters everywhere Christmas Day....
Fences: Denzel Washington and Viola Davis give powerful performances in this film based on Pulitzer Prize-winner August Wilson’s drama. Washington also directs this tale of a flawed man and his troubled relationship with his family shadowed by his own personal disappointments, frailties, and social change. At times it does have the feel of watching a stage play on the big screen, but the acting alone makes this one of the best dramas of 2017. 4 1/2 stars.
La La Land: THE movie to see Christmas Day is La La Land. It truly is a 21st-century update of the musical that not only hits the right notes but has a screen pairing of Emma Stone and Ryan Goslin that audiences will adore. Simply put it is a contemporary Hollywood love story about 2 artists trying to make their way in the business. Yet it ends in a way that should make Hollywood proud. You'll know what I mean when you see it - which you should. The Phoenix Film Critics Society named it the best picture of 2016. 5 stars.
Already in theaters...
Passengers: Jennifer Lawrence and Chris Pratt play cute in this sci-fi romance. They’re on a spaceship that’s heading to colonize a planet that takes more than century to reach. So, it’s a bit of a problem when they wake up from their pods a little early. Though the romance is interesting, this film doesn’t engage enough with a storyline about problems plaguing their journey which will keep you on the edge of your seat. 3 out of 5
Catch Up With…
Manchester By The Sea: Casey Affleck gives what is probably the best actor performance of the year in this Kenneth Lonergan film. Affleck effectively plays a man wearing a mantle of grief after his beloved brother dies and he’s left to raise his nephew. This is a role he does not want to take on. While the film is shrouded in sadness, Lonergan effectively having characters that at times break your heart and make you laugh. Note: the language in this film is NOT for the faint of heart. 4 stars
Moana: One thing you have to credit Disney for and that’s not shying away from female leads. In Moana, the titular character is set to become the chief of her clan. However, she set to inherit an island that has some ecological troubles that can only be resolved with her taking a forbidden adventure. Throw in Lin-Manuel Miranda’s musical stylings and The Rock as demigod Maui and you’ve got one fun adventure. No need to take kids as cover for this film. Just go and enjoy it.
